Business Context and Reporting Period
CI&T Inc (NYSE: CINT), a global technology transformation specialist, reported its financial results for the fourth quarter (4Q24) and full year ended December 31, 2024. The company serves over 100 large enterprises with expertise in AI, cloud services, and software development. As of December 31, 2024, CI&T employed 6,907 professionals across nine countries. The company announced a transition of its presentation currency from Brazilian Reais (BRL) to U.S. Dollars (USD) starting with its 2024 Annual Report on Form 20-F, though the functional currency remains BRL.
Key Financial Metrics
Fourth Quarter 2024 (4Q24)
- Net Revenue: R$656.5 million (up 25.6% vs. 4Q23; 14.7% at constant currency).
- Net Profit: R$61.7 million (up 169% vs. 4Q23).
- Adjusted EBITDA: R$128.1 million (up 23.7% vs. 4Q23); margin of 19.5%.
- Adjusted Net Profit: R$78.2 million (up 41.3% vs. 4Q23); margin of 11.9%.
- Adjusted Gross Profit Margin: 37.4% (up 1.8 percentage points vs. 4Q23).
Full Year 2024
- Net Revenue: R$2,367.8 million (up 6.0% vs. 2023; 1.3% at constant currency).
- Net Profit: R$161.2 million (up 21.6% vs. 2023).
- Adjusted EBITDA: R$442.4 million (up 2.4% vs. 2023); margin of 18.7%.
- Adjusted Net Profit: R$241.9 million (up 8.9% vs. 2023); margin of 10.2%.
- Cash Flow: Operating cash flow increased 12.7% to R$467.0 million.
- Liquidity and Debt: Cash and cash equivalents totaled R$350.6 million. Total loans and borrowings were R$859.0 million (R$286.2 million current; R$572.8 million non-current).
Material Changes vs. Prior Period
- Revenue Growth Drivers: 4Q24 revenue growth was driven by strategic investments, new sales initiatives, and a 40.4% increase in revenue from the top 10 clients. The Retail and Industrial Goods sector saw a 109.4% increase in 4Q24 revenue.
- Expense Management: Selling, general, and administrative (SG&A) expenses rose 15.9% in 4Q24 due to sales team expansion and profit-sharing costs. However, net finance costs decreased 15.4% year-over-year for the full year due to a lower debt position and positive foreign exchange variations.
- Profitability: Net profit surged 169% in 4Q24, significantly outpacing revenue growth, aided by a lower effective tax rate (31.8% for 2024 vs. 36.6% in 2023) and improved gross margins.
- Geographic Mix: North America accounted for 44.4% of 2024 revenue, followed by Latin America at 41.5%.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
Business Outlook
- 1Q25 Revenue: Expected to be at least USD 110.5 million (approx. 12.6% growth at constant currency).
- Full Year 2025: Net revenue growth at constant currency is projected between 9% and 15%. Adjusted EBITDA margin is expected to range from 18% to 20%.
Risks and Contingencies
- Geopolitical Factors: Risks include the ongoing war in Ukraine, sanctions on Russia, and the conflict between Israel and Hamas.
- Market Conditions: Uncertainty regarding demand for services, competition, and general economic conditions.
- Integration: Risks associated with integrating recently acquired businesses and executing the nearshoring strategy.
- Currency Volatility: The company notes that actual results may differ due to foreign exchange fluctuations, particularly given the transition to USD reporting.
